Senior Staff Software Engineer, Data PlatformChennai, India

1 month ago


Chennai, India Udemy Full time

About this role

 

Are you excited about building a Data Mesh platform on a global scale? Do you want to build a self-service, highly scalable platform to power Udemy’s groundbreaking AI, ML, and data products? Udemy’s Data org is looking for a self-driven, creative Data Mesh platform engineer passionate about changing the world by democratizing online education.

We are building highly available, scalable data infrastructure, services, tools, and libraries to serve critical data discovery, ML/data pipeline development & deployment, data security & compliance, and self-healing data operation needs.

What you'll be doing

Design, build, enhance, and support self-service data infrastructure as a platform, which would be used for Udemy’s data mesh. Build robust, scalable, cloud-native, cost-optimized real-time and batch data integration pipelines in AWS with Airflow, Kafka, Databricks, Delta Lake, AWS services like S3, EMR, Athena, RDS, Redshift, EKS, etc., and Snowflake. Contribute towards Udemy's comprehensive data quality initiatives like data contracts, data validation, observability, and alerting Support data platform privacy with RBAC and encryption On-call rotation business hours

What you’ll have

8+ years of experience in building distributed systems with Java, Scala, or Python 5+ years of experience managing big data platforms with storage (AWS S3), compute (AWS EMR or Databricks with Spark, AWS Athena or Presto), data warehouses (Redshift or Snowflake), streaming (Kafka or AWS Kinesis) 5+ years of experience in agile development methodologies & test-driven development (TDD) 5+ years of experience building and maintaining resilient real-time & batch data pipelines. Experience in building or using any one of the data quality tools (in-house built, SODA SQL, Anomalo, Monte Carlo, Great Expectations, or any other) Expertise in cloud data privacy tools in the area of authentication (AWS IAM/OKTA), encryption (AWS KMS/Safenet), authorization (Apache Ranger/Privacera) Strong grasp of object-oriented design patterns, algorithms, and data structures

We understand that not everyone will match each of the above qualifications. However, we also realize that everyone has unique experiences that can add value to our company. Even if you think your background might not perfectly align, we'd love to hear from you



  • Chennai, India Udemy Full time

    About this roleAre you excited about building a Data Mesh platform on a global scale? Do you want to build a self-service, highly scalable platform to power Udemy’s groundbreaking AI, ML, and data products? Udemy’s Data org is looking for a self-driven, creative Data Mesh platform engineer passionate about changing the world by democratizing online...


  • chennai, India Udemy Full time

    About this role   Are you excited about building a Data Mesh platform on a global scale? Do you want to build a self-service, highly scalable platform to power Udemy’s groundbreaking AI, ML, and data products? Udemy’s Data org is looking for a self-driven, creative Data Mesh platform engineer passionate about changing the world by democratizing...


  • Chennai, Tamil Nadu, India NTT Data Vertex Software Inc. Full time

    We are looking for a skilled Senior Software Engineer to join our team at Career Progress Consultants in Chennai! Position: Senior Software Engineer Location: Chennai Experience: 5 - 9 years If you have several years of experience in software development and are passionate about creating high-quality code, we want to hear from you! Join us in...


  • Chennai, India MaxLinear Full time

    ResponsibilitiesMaxLinear is seeking a Senior Staff Software Engineer to join our growing team. In this role, you will focus on the following:Development of next generation wireless communications and broadband products like multi-gigabit Wi-Fi and broadband routers, mesh networks and distributed systems providing high speed data connectivityPre- and...


  • Chennai, India NTT DATA Full time

    Job Description Req ID: 277685 N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now.We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India...


  • chennai, India NTT DATA Full time

    Job Description Req ID:  277685  N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N),...


  • chennai, India NTT DATA Full time

    Job Description Req ID:  277685  N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N),...


  • Chennai, India MaxLinear Full time

    Responsibilities MaxLinear is seeking a Senior Staff Software Engineer to join our growing team. In this role, you will focus on the following: Development of next generation wireless communications and broadband products like multi-gigabit Wi-Fi and broadband routers, mesh networks and distributed systems providing high speed data connectivity ...


  • Chennai, India NTT DATA Services Full time

    Req ID:277685N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now.We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N).Who we are:NTT...


  • chennai, India MaxLinear Full time

    Responsibilities MaxLinear is seeking a Senior Staff Software Engineer to join our growing team. In this role, you will focus on the following: Development of next generation wireless communications and broadband products like multi-gigabit Wi-Fi and broadband routers, mesh networks and distributed systems providing high speed data...


  • chennai, India NTT DATA Full time

    Job Description Req ID:  276347  N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Senior Software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N)....


  • Chennai, India Walmart Global Tech India Full time

    Staff Software Engineer - Full Stack (Frontend - React js/ Javascript and Java/Node js)About Team:Enterprise Business Services is invested in building a compact, robust organization that includes service operations and technology solutions for Finance, People, Associate Digital Experience. We are Leaders & learnings domain in Walmart EBS People tech. We work...


  • Chennai, India Walmart Global Tech India Full time

    Staff Software Engineer - Full Stack (Frontend - React js/ Javascript and Java/Node js) About Team: Enterprise Business Services is invested in building a compact, robust organization that includes service operations and technology solutions for Finance, People, Associate Digital Experience. We are Leaders & learnings domain in Walmart EBS People tech. We...


  • chennai, India NTT DATA Services Full time

    Req ID:  277685  N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N). Who we...


  • Chennai, India NTT DATA Full time

    Job Description Req ID: 274965 N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now.We are currently seeking a Senior Software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N).We...


  • chennai, India NTT DATA Full time

    Job Description Req ID:  274965  N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Senior Software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N)....


  • Chennai, India NTT DATA Full time

    Job Description Req ID: 274966 N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now.We are currently seeking a Senior Software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N).we...


  • Chennai, India Udemy Full time

    About this roleAs a Senior Staff Data Scientist on the Globalization team, you will build scalable search algorithms fueled by machine learning, natural language processing and data-driven processes. You will create technical roadmaps to lead the technical vision of the Globalization team. You will collaborate with other Data Scientists, Product Managers and...


  • Chennai, India NTT DATA Services Full time

    Req ID: 277685 N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now.We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India (IN).Who we...


  • Chennai, India NTT DATA Services Full time

    Req ID: 277685  NTT DATA Services strives to hire exceptional, innovative and passionate individuals who want to grow with us. If you want to be part of an inclusive, adaptable, and forward-thinking organization, apply now. We are currently seeking a Digital Engineering Staff Engineer to join our team in Chennai, Tamil Nādu (IN-TN), India...